KYOTO, Aug 17 (News On Japan) - Kyoto’s traditional Obon event, Gozan no Okuribi -- more commonly known as Daimonji -- was held on Saturday night, sending off the spirits of ancestors who returned to the living world during Obon, while also offering prayers for good health.
Despite the rain, large crowds gathered with umbrellas in hand to spend time watching the flickering fire.
According to the Kyoto Prefectural Police, about 22,000 people gathered at five sites across the city this year.
